International Rugby comes to Saracens
This coming weekend will be an historic one for women's rugby at Saracens.
For the first time, the Saracens, Bramley road ground will play host to a Women’s International game between Wales and the International Nomads. Wales are hoping to build on their recent success against Italy. The Nomads will field a host of invited internationals from different countries around the world. Players represent, Samoa, Australia, Scotland, Canada, England and New Zealand. Always an exciting fixture and a dynamic team to follow.
This is the first of three fixtures for the Nomads this season with two future fixtures against England A.

The game will kick-off at 1pm. After the women’s game the game between England and the All Blacks will be shown on the big screen and multi-TV facility in the clubhouse.
